British Council Women in STEM Scholarships 2026–27 Details

  • Host Country: United Kingdom
  • Host Organization: British Council
  • Study Level: Master’s Degree
  • Financial Coverage: Fully Funded
  • Eligibility: International Students (Women Only)

Benefits of British Council Women in STEM Scholarships 2026–2027

  • Full tuition fee coverage
  • Monthly living stipend
  • Travel costs to and from the UK
  • Visa and health coverage fees
  • Refund of IELTS English language test fee (if required)

List of Eligible Countries

Applicants must be citizens of one of the following countries:

India, Pakistan, Bangladesh, Kosovo, Nepal, Sri Lanka, Cambodia, Indonesia, Laos, Malaysia, Philippines, Thailand, Vietnam, Albania,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Myanmar, Kazakhstan, North Macedonia, Serbia, Uzbekistan, Turkey, Argentina, Brazil, Montenegro, Colombia, Cuba, Jamaica, Mexico, Peru, Venezuela, Egypt

Eligibility Criteria for British Council Women in STEM Scholarships 2026–27

  • Applicants must be women from eligible countries.
  • Must be willing to begin studies in the UK in September/October 2026.
  • Must demonstrate financial need.
  • Must hold an undergraduate degree that qualifies them for a Master’s program.
  • English language proficiency is mandatory.
  • Dual nationality holders are not eligible.
  • Must show active engagement or strong interest in their STEM field.
  • Must not be receiving financial support from any other UK scholarship source.
  • Preference is given to candidates with leadership potential and a strong commitment to gender equality in STEM.

Required Documents

  • Completed scholarship application form
  • Academic transcripts and certificates
  • Proof of English language proficiency (IELTS or equivalent)
  • Curriculum Vitae (CV)
  • Personal statement / motivation letter
  • Letters of recommendation
  • Copy of passport

Application Deadline

The application deadline for the British Council Women in STEM Scholarships 2026–2027 varies by participating UK university.

Applicants are advised to check the official British Council website and partner university pages for exact deadlines.
